About Maitland Baldwin
Maitland Baldwin is a scholar working on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ine, Neurology and Psychiatry and Mental health, having authored 45 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Epilepsy research and treatment (6 papers), Thermal Regulation in Medicine (5 papers) and Traumatic Brain Injury and Neurovascular Disturbances (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Neurology (307 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(295 citations) and Otorhinolaryngology (58 citations). Maitland Baldwin has collaborated with scholars based in United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include A. K. Ommaya, Giovanni Di Chiro, Joe Pennybacker, Ayub K. Ommaya, John M. Van Buren, Charles D. Wood, Thomas A. Waldmann, S. David Rockoff, Thomas H. Milhorat and Anatole S. Dekaban. Their work appears in journals such as Science, Brain and Neurology.
